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0252 586997 0446090 69886 82532
1508570644 50888853669
1508570644 50888853669
840339300 657 844 361
All about undefined
Interested in learning more?
1508570644 50888853669
840339300 657 844 361
See more
97 8985356 9801197796
362476085 2942234075 69594
See more
09 639
7222989 07 77 391
See more